I started up Elephant Mountain Road, following the tracks of what looked like just one snowmobile. The snow was soft and made for slower going than expected. About a mile short of the bushwhack start, the snowmobile tracks turned, leaving me to break trail. I am not certain that I started the whack in the typical spot, but it was an opening with many trees leaning over it. I headed up the cuts, dealing with spruce traps, and lots of deep snow. Occasionally I had to push through thick stuff. This was followed by some fairly open woods. This section was steeper and had some buried spruce. The summit push required me to work through some really, really thick snow covered spruce. The snow coverage was to the point that it was like stepping into a tunnel. I pushed through this and reached the highpoint. I followed my tracks out. This was a hard hike. I sunk to my waist many times and my chest a few. Lots of tough trail breaking. |
